About Epic Bible College & Graduate School

Epic Bible College & Graduate School is a private four-year university located in Sacramento, California. It is ranked #4199 nationally and #473 in California by our composite scoring methodology. Epic Bible College & Graduate School has a test-optional admissions policy. It enrolls approximately 60 students , with costs below the national average.
